An original enamel bicycle head tube badge for Stucchi & Co of Milano. Prinetti & Stucchi is where Ettore Bugatti started his where he first deigned the motorised tricycle considered to be the first Bugatti. In c.1901 he left Stucchi to start Bugatti. Worldwide delivery.
